All carpet cleaning machines essentially do the same thing:
1. Wet the carpet with a cleaning solution.
2. Scrub the carpet with brushes
3. Suck the cleaning solution and dirt out of the carpet
What distinguishes a carpet cleaning machine is how easily, conveniently and thoroughly it can do those three things.
For this machine, assembly out-of-the-box requires a Phillips screwdriver and about five minutes. Most of this machine is made of plastic. From the side, it looks like a huge red and black running shoe with a handle on it. It comes with a hose and three attachments; one narrow cleaning tool with brush, one wider cleaning tool with brush and a crevice tool. They are for cleaning hard-to-reach corners and upholstery. A switch on the bottom front of the machine toggles between operating the machine upright or through the hose. All of the tools have a convenient push-button sprayer on them.

I decided to replace my old Bissell as it had stop extracting, the brushes had stopped turning... just worn out I suppose. I purchased the Bissell Deap clean. The good - well the brush was a nice change from the small individual ones in the past. Supposed to have heat which may be just a light , I couldn't tell any difference. The bad was the tank. Super small and a weird - fill this plastic bag with solution then as it is emptied the bag will collapse and be deflated by dirty captured solution ...... hmmm. The most frustrating part was there is no indicator for the tank being empty or full. It "looks" like it is still sucking up fluid when in reality the tank is empty and you are no longer applying new fluid. The final straw before I was to return it was as I set it down in the sink to empty it the tank cracked rendering it useless. I would say this is a poor design and I opted to get the ProHeat 2X Healthy Home Upright Deep Cleaner, 66Q4 which is a far better machine.
